## Data Stores: Zero-Downtime Migrations

If you're on call and a migration is running, don't panic — Fernwhistle migrations are expand/contract by design. New columns are added first, dual-writes run for at least one deploy cycle, and the old column is only dropped after the backfill job reports clean. Never kill a backfill mid-run; it's resumable, and killing it just resets the checkpoint. Progress lives in the `migration_ledger` table. To check ledger state or pause a backfill, connect to the primary using the string below.

primary connection of yagep-kahip = redis://giliel_svc:zYiKsLL2PLpfPL@db-348f.xolmarsys.corp:5432/fenwyn

// Broker upgrade notes for plugin authors:
// Quillbus 4.x replaces the legacy 3.x wire protocol. Plugins must
// construct the client with explicit protocol negotiation enabled,
// or connections to the Larkfield cluster will be silently downgraded
// and dropped after 30s. Topic names are unchanged. For local testing
// against the sandbox broker, authenticate with the key below.

API key for bafof-bagaf: qvz2-qi

# Liftplan elevator-dispatch simulator — env config
# Maintainers: SIM_FLOORS and CAR_COUNT must match the Denwick tower profile.
# TICK_MS below 50 breaks the queue model; don't touch it.
# Results post to the metrics collector, which requires an auth token.
# Rotate quarterly per the Liftplan ops calendar.
# The collector token is set on the next line.

sealed setting: ARCHIVE_KEY3=8d0

Team: we move Corvalis subscriptions to annual billing on 1 March. Rationale: cash flow smoothing, 20% lower collection costs, stickier accounts. Risk: short-term churn among month-to-month users, estimated 6%. Mitigation: two-month grace pricing and Darnell's migration playbook. Finance models show breakeven by Q2, net positive thereafter. Legal has cleared the revised terms. Board materials circulate Friday. One strategic consideration is not for wider distribution and appears in the confidential note below.

board note of tadup-tajog: Headcount on the Oliiel team goes from 31 to 88 by the end of February. Gross margin on Oliiel came in at 62 percent against a plan of 29 percent.